These families are best known for the nymphal stage, which produces a cover of foamed-up plant sap visually resembling saliva; the nymphs are therefore commonly known as spittlebugs and their foam as cuckoo spit, frog spit, or snake spit. This characteristic spittle production is associated with the unusual trait of xylem feeding. WebFeb 19, 2024 · The eggs overwinter on the host plant and hatch in the spring. The soft-bodied nymphs emerge wingless and green. Then the work of creating the spittle shelter begins! Within the course of several weeks and in the safety of its cuckoo spit foam home, the spittlebug goes through three more stages to become a froghopper.
